Smartworks Revenue Jumps 44% to ₹546 Cr in Q1 FY27
AI Summary
Smartworks Coworking Spaces Ltd reported a 44% year-on-year increase in revenue to ₹546 crore for the quarter ended June 30, 2026. Normalised Profit After Tax (PAT) nearly tripled to ₹39 crore, up from ₹13 crore in the prior year. The company also announced plans for the world's largest managed office campus in Pune, scheduled to open in H2 FY27. With ₹5,400 crore of revenue already contracted, Smartworks reiterated its full-year guidance and highlighted strong demand from large enterprises, with clients having over 1,000 seats contributing 41% of rental revenue.
